// GET: ExpeditedFreights/Edit/5 public ActionResult Edit(int?id) { var expeditedfreights = db.ExpeditedFreights.SingleOrDefault(c => c.ExpeditedFreightId == id); var statuses = db.Statuses.ToList(); var customers = db.Customers.ToList(); var customerdivisions = db.CustomerDivisions.ToList(); var mlsdivisions = db.MlsDivisions.ToList(); var viewModel = new SaveExpFreightViewModel() { ExpeditedFreight = expeditedfreights, Statuses = statuses, Customers = customers, CustomerDivisions = customerdivisions, MlsDivisions = mlsdivisions }; if (id == null) { return(new HttpStatusCodeResult(HttpStatusCode.BadRequest)); } ExpeditedFreight expeditedFreight = db.ExpeditedFreights.Find(id); if (expeditedFreight == null) { return(HttpNotFound()); } return(View("Edit", viewModel)); //return View(expeditedFreight); }
public ActionResult DeleteConfirmed(int id) { ExpeditedFreight expeditedFreight = db.ExpeditedFreights.Find(id); db.ExpeditedFreights.Remove(expeditedFreight); db.SaveChanges(); return(RedirectToAction("Index")); }
//public ActionResult Edit([Bind(Include = "ExpeditedFreightId,ExpeditedFreightNo,StatusId, PartNumber,ExpeditedFreightType,RequestedBy,RequestDateTime,InvoiceNo, NeedDateTime,Destination,Reason,Notes")] ExpeditedFreight expeditedFreight) public ActionResult Edit(ExpeditedFreight expeditedFreight) { if (ModelState.IsValid) { db.Entry(expeditedFreight).State = EntityState.Modified; db.SaveChanges(); return(RedirectToAction("Index")); } return(View(expeditedFreight)); }
//public ActionResult Create([Bind(Include = "ExpeditedFreightId,ExpeditedFreightNo,PartNumber,StatusId, ExpeditedFreightType,RequestedBy,RequestDateTime,NeedDateTime,InvoiceNo, Destination,Reason,Notes")] ExpeditedFreight expeditedFreight) public ActionResult Create(ExpeditedFreight expeditedFreight) { if (ModelState.IsValid) { db.ExpeditedFreights.Add(expeditedFreight); db.SaveChanges(); return(RedirectToAction("Index")); } return(View()); //return View(expeditedFreight); }
// GET: ExpeditedFreights/Details/5 public ActionResult Details(int?id) { if (id == null) { return(new HttpStatusCodeResult(HttpStatusCode.BadRequest)); } ExpeditedFreight expeditedFreight = db.ExpeditedFreights.Find(id); if (expeditedFreight == null) { return(HttpNotFound()); } return(View(expeditedFreight)); }